Output d4d380d1e90c9c34343243e70c53cce4cc52b6fb78e892ecaaad65789152f482:2

value
636376
script pubkey
OP_0 OP_PUSHBYTES_20 d1cac91a8f40996db624cb1bcf2fbe9d45d6238f
address
bc1q689vjx50gzvkmd3yevdu7ta7n4zavgu00x2ynr
transaction
d4d380d1e90c9c34343243e70c53cce4cc52b6fb78e892ecaaad65789152f482
confirmations
95749
spent
true